Understanding the 45ft Container
A 45ft container is a standardized intermodal freight container that determines 45 feet in length, around 8 feet in width, and 9.6 feet in height. This size is developed to take full advantage of cargo capacity while maintaining compatibility with existing transport infrastructure, such as ports, ships, and railways. The 45ft sea containers container is usually utilized for bulk shipments that require extra area, making it an ideal option for industries with high volume requirements.
Key Features of 45ft Containers
- Increased Capacity: The 45ft container uses about 25% more space than a basic 40ft container, permitting bigger deliveries without the need for multiple smaller containers.
- Resilience: Built from top-quality steel and strengthened with cross-members, these containers are developed to stand up to severe climate condition and the rigors of long-distance travel.
- Security: Equipped with robust locking mechanisms and tamper-evident seals, 45ft containers provide improved security for important and sensitive cargo.
- Flexibility: They can be utilized for a large range of goods, from dry bulk products to refrigerated products, thanks to their numerous configurations and modifications.
- Performance: The larger size lowers the number of dealing with operations, conserving time and lowering the danger of damage throughout transit.

Resilience and Construction
The durability of 45ft containers is a key consider their extensive usage. These containers are constructed from top quality materials and undergo strenuous testing to ensure they can manage the needs of international shipping. The following features add to their toughness:
- Corrosion Resistance: The usage of corrosion-resistant steel and protective coverings ensures that the container stays in good condition even after prolonged direct exposure to saltwater and other harsh components.
- Structural Integrity: Reinforced corners and cross-members provide extra strength, preventing contortion under heavy loads and harsh conditions.
- Weatherproofing: Sealed doors and a water tight style safeguard the cargo from rain, snow, and other ecological elements.
- Impact Resistance: The thick walls and tough building hold up against the effects of loading, unloading, and transport, reducing the threat of cargo damage.

FAQs About 45ft Containers
Q: What is the internal volume of a Used 45ft containers container?A: The internal volume of a 45ft container is normally around 3060 cubic feet (86.6 cubic meters), providing sufficient area for big shipments.
Q: Are 45ft containers ideal for all types of cargo?A: While 45ft containers are extremely flexible, they are not appropriate for all types of cargo. Specialized containers, such as insulated or cooled systems, are required for temperature-sensitive goods.
Q: How do 45ft containers compare to 40ft containers in regards to cost?A: Although 45ft containers have a greater initial cost, they can be more economical for large deliveries due to reduced handling and lower per-unit shipping costs.
Q: Can 45ft containers be stacked?A: Yes, 45ft container solutions containers are designed to be stacked, however the variety of containers that can be safely stacked might differ depending upon the structural stability of the containers and the weight of the cargo.
Q: Are there any constraints to using 45ft containers?A: Some constraints include the requirement for specialized handling equipment and possible constraints at specific ports or on specific routes. Furthermore, the extra length may present obstacles in regards to maneuverability and storage space.
